Defining 1440p and 2K
What Is 1440p?
1440p, also known as QHD (Quad High Definition) or WQHD (Wide Quad HD), refers to a display resolution of 2560×1440 pixels. This resolution is part of a trend that emerged in the early 2010s, offering a significant upgrade over the popular 1080p resolution (1920×1080). The “1440” in 1440p comes from the vertical pixel count, and the “p” stands for progressive scan, meaning that the entire image is refreshed each frame.
What Is 2K?
The term 2K is a bit more complicated. Generally, it is used to describe any display resolution with a horizontal pixel count close to 2000 pixels. In cinematic terms, 2K resolution is officially defined as 2048×1080 pixels. However, in the consumer electronics market, especially in discussions about monitors and televisions, “2K” often refers to a resolution of 2560×1440 pixels, which is the same as 1440p.
The Relationship Between 1440p and 2K
At this juncture, you may be wondering whether 1440p and 2K are equivalent. The answer is, it depends on the context.
In Cinematic Terms
In the film industry, where resolutions are standardized, 2K is synonymous with 2048×1080 pixels. Therefore, in this realm, 1440p will not qualify as 2K due to its differing vertical pixel count. It is crucial to note that cinematic resolution distinctions often emphasize the unique requirements of film projection and editing.
In Consumer Electronics Terms
When you shift the focus to consumer displays, 1440p is frequently embraced under the 2K umbrella. Manufacturers and discussions related to gaming monitors typically utilize the term “2K” to market 2560×1440 displays as a superior option compared to 1080p. In most marketing contexts, a 1440p monitor may be labeled as 2K, leading to consumer confusion.

Key Benefits of 1440p / 2K Resolution
Regardless of the label you use, the 1440p or 2K resolution undoubtedly provides an impressive step up from 1080p. Here are some key benefits:
Improved Clarity and Detail
With nearly four million pixels packed into a 2560×1440 display, 1440p offers superior clarity compared to 1920×1080. This means improved detail in scenes, textures, and overall sharpness, making it an attractive option for gamers and graphic designers alike.
Enhanced Gaming Experience
Gamers often seek resolutions that offer a balance between performance and visual fidelity. Many modern graphics cards can handle 1440p gaming reasonably well, leading to smoother gameplay and vibrant visuals. This is particularly significant in fast-paced games where reaction time and clarity can impact performance.
A Compromise Between 1080p and 4K
While 4K (3840×2160) represents the pinnacle of resolution quality, it demands significant hardware performance, often necessitating expensive graphics cards. In this context, 1440p serves as an impressive midpoint. It offers a marked improvement over 1080p visuals without overwhelming the system demands of 4K.
Table: Comparison of Resolutions
| Resolution | Horizontal Pixels | Vertical Pixels | Total Pixels | Typical Use |
|---|---|---|---|---|
| 1080p | 1920 | 1080 | 2,073,600 | Standard HD |
| 1440p | 2560 | 1440 | 3,686,400 | Gaming, Professional Use |
| 4K | 3840 | 2160 | 8,294,400 | High-end Movies, Gaming |
| 2K (Cinema) | 2048 | 1080 | 2,211,840 | Film Production |

What is 2K resolution?
The term “2K” typically refers to a resolution of 2048 x 1080 pixels. This resolution is commonly associated with digital cinema and film production, where it is used to ensure high-quality imaging. The designation “2K” indicates that the horizontal pixel count is around 2000, which fits the film industry’s classification system.
While the 2K resolution often appears in cinema, it is worth noting that the term can sometimes be used more loosely to describe any resolutions in the 2000-pixel range, including 1440p. However, strictly speaking, 2K and 1440p are distinct resolutions, with 2K being slightly lower than QHD in terms of vertical pixel count.
Is 1440p considered 2K?
There is some confusion surrounding whether 1440p can be classified as 2K. While both resolutions have similar uses in gaming and content consumption, 1440p (2560 x 1440) has more pixels than the traditional 2K resolution (2048 x 1080). As such, many enthusiasts and tech sources often do not classify 1440p as 2K.
It is important to note that, although 1440p may sometimes be referred to as “2K” in modern discussions about display technology, it technically exceeds the standard 2K resolution. This discrepancy highlights the need for clarity regarding the terms used when discussing various display formats.

What hardware is required to support 1440p gaming?
To experience gaming at 1440p, a compatible graphics card is essential. Mid to high-end GPUs from manufacturers like NVIDIA and AMD can handle 1440p resolutions effectively. Typically, graphics cards such as the NVIDIA GeForce RTX 2060 or AMD Radeon RX 5600 XT and above will provide suitable performance for gaming at this resolution.
It’s not just the GPU that matters; having a capable monitor with a refresh rate that matches your hardware is also vital. Pairing your graphics card with a 1440p monitor that supports higher refresh rates (like 144Hz or more) enhances overall gaming performance and experience, making graphics smoother and minimizing motion blur during fast-paced gameplay.
